Understanding Sealed Diaphragm Pressure Gauges
Sealed diaphragm pressure gauges operate on the principle of a flexible diaphragm that separates the pressure measurement chamber from the ambient environment. As pressure is applied to one side of the diaphragm, it deflects, causing a linked needle to move on a calibrated dial, thus indicating the pressure. The sealed aspect refers to the gauge being hermetically sealed to prevent contamination from dust, moisture, and other environmental factors, which can adversely affect performance and accuracy.
Advantages of Sealed Diaphragm Pressure Gauges
1. Protection Against Contaminants One of the standout features of sealed diaphragm pressure gauges is their ability to operate in harsh environments. By preventing dust, moisture, and corrosive substances from entering the instrument, these gauges maintain their accuracy and performance over time.
2. Enhanced Accuracy Because they are less susceptible to external factors, sealed diaphragm pressure gauges tend to provide more accurate readings than traditional gauges. This reliability is critical in industries where precision is essential, such as pharmaceuticals, food processing, and chemical manufacturing.
3. Durability and Longevity These gauges are designed for durability. With their sealed construction, they can withstand high pressure, vibrations, and temperature variations better than non-sealed counterparts. This robust construction leads to reduced maintenance costs and longer service life, making them a cost-effective choice.
4. Wide Range of Applications Sealed diaphragm pressure gauges can be used in various applications, from monitoring pressure in hydraulic systems to providing readings in HVAC systems, water treatment facilities, and oil and gas industries. Their versatility makes them a go-to choice for many engineers and technicians.
5. Ease of Installation and Use These gauges are typically designed for easy installation, saving both time and labor costs. Additionally, their user-friendly interfaces, often with clear dial markings, allow for straightforward operation, even for personnel who may not be specialized in pressure measurement.
